Output 2689307826f534a0a14add11432b12a6dbd512347084195685097953702f813f:18

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74a11e7ce7816529f48992e4d0ff142a3f0d855c OP_EQUAL
address
3CKhKYgBqJK6vpe1pHYivMhWvRBhyUMaC4
transaction
2689307826f534a0a14add11432b12a6dbd512347084195685097953702f813f
spent
true